Tribology of polypropylene and Li-complex greases with ZDDP and MoDTC additives [PDF]

open access: yes, 2017
The influence of thickener and additive interactions on grease lubricating performance is examined. Polypropylene and lithium complex thickened (Li-complex) greases were tested both as neat greases and with a 2 wt% addition of ZDDP and/or MoDTC.

Surface Analysis of Chain Joint Components after Tribological Load and Usage of Antiwear Additives

open access: yesConference Papers in Science, Volume 2015, Issue 1, 2015., 2015
Wear in chain joints leads to an increased clearance and thus an elongation of the entire chain which determines the lifetime of the chain. This particularly applies for chains that are used in timing chain drives.
